This backcountry hiking trail has a total elevation difference of 1,719 feet which is about average. The time needed for this walk is roughly 3 hours, but of course some people walk a bit slower and some a bit faster. Being 3.6 miles long it's a short trail. This great outdoors hiking trail is not that long but it's always perfect to bring some emergency supplies, you never know what could happen. Big Boulder Trail goes through some very different elevations, and that means that some parts of the trail could be very different from other parts of it. At parts of the year this neighborhood sees very little rain, so do check for current fire restrictions before you go if you plan to bring a stove or make a camp fire. This backcountry hiking trail has only one trailhead, so you'll be hiking it in and back out.
